A quarterback throws an incomplete pass. The height of the football at time t is modeled by the equation h(t) = –16t2 + 40t + 7. Rounded to the nearest tenth, the solutions to the equation when h(t) = 0 feet are –0.2 s and 2.7 s. Which solution can be eliminated and why?

A
The solution –0.2 s can be eliminated because time cannot be a negative value.
B
The solution –0.2 s can be eliminated because the pass was not thrown backward.
C
The solution 2.7 s can be eliminated because the pass was thrown backward.
D
The solution 2.7 s can be eliminated because a ball cannot be in the air for that long due to gravity.

When using a quadratic equation in the form y = ax2 + bx + c to model the height of a projectile (y) over time (x), which of the following is always represented by the constant term?

A
the initial height of the projectile
B
the initial velocity of the projectile
C
the time at which the projectile hits the ground
D
the maximum height of the projectile
